ACE Training Wins Sustainable Further Education/College of the Year at the Oxford Climate Awards 2025

We are so pleased and proud to share that ACE Training has been named Sustainable Further Education/College of the Year at the Oxford Climate Awards 2025!

These awards shine a spotlight on the individuals, organisations and businesses championing environmental sustainability, and it was an honour to celebrate at the absolutely stunning Oxford Town Hall.

This is our second year running as finalists, and to come away with the win is a fantastic recognition of the way we embed green practices into everything we do. Congratulations go to our fellow finalists, Activate Learning and Wadham College, Oxford University, for the inspiring work they are doing, and thank you to Lucy Group Ltd, our category sponsor.

We were recognised for the wide range of sustainable practices embedded in our day-to-day operations from generating 75% of our electricity through solar panels and powering electric minibuses, to reusing timber offcuts to heat workshops and drastically reducing waste through recycling and repurposing. Our learners actively contribute too, building eco-projects for the community, working with reclaimed materials and gaining hands-on experience that brings sustainability to life.
